Question: A 3-day-old newborn presents with widespread, non-blanching, bluish-purple macules and papules over the skin. The parents report that the baby was born at term with no complications during delivery. The lesions appear mottled and are particularly concentrated on the trunk, arms, and legs. The infant is otherwise feeding well and shows no signs of distress. Laboratory evaluation reveals mild thrombocytopenia and elevated bilirubin levels. Given these findings, which of the following is the most likely diagnosis?
A. Hemangiopericytoma
B. Hemangioma
C. Glomangioma
D. Blueberry Muffin Rash

Ques . A 20-year-old male presents to the clinic with a complaint of a scaly rash that has developed over his trunk. He reports that the rash is not itchy. His medical history reveals that he had a mild fever and headaches about two weeks ago. The patient is an outdoor enthusiast, spending much of his free time outside. On physical examination, the rash is predominantly located on his central trunk, with no visible lesions on his arms or legs.
Based on this presentation, what is the most likely diagnosis?
A. Erythema Annulare Centrifugum
B. Nummular Dermatitis (Nummular Eczema)
C. Pityriasis Rosea
D. Seborrheic Dermatitis

A 71-year-old woman with a history of Type 2 Diabetes Mellitus presents with fever and a widespread rash. Eight days prior to the onset of these symptoms, she was started on sulfamethoxazole–trimethoprim to treat cellulitis. Upon physical examination, she is found to have oral mucosal erosions and bilateral conjunctival injection (redness). Additionally, the patient has developed extensive blistering and skin denudation affecting approximately 70% of her body surface area.
What is the most likely diagnosis based on her clinical presentation?
A. Staphylococcal Scalded Skin Syndrome (SSSS)
B. Hypersensitivity Vasculitis
C. Toxic Epidermal Necrolysis
D. Chemical Burns

Question:
A 35-year-old man presents to the clinic with a 10-day history of a cutaneous lesion on his chest. He reports that the lesion first appeared 24 hours after he began taking a self-prescribed course of oral trimethoprim–sulfamethoxazole to treat a respiratory tract infection. The lesion has progressively worsened and is characterized by erythema and potential discomfort. Given the timing of the appearance of the lesion in relation to the initiation of antibiotic therapy, what is the most likely diagnosis?
A. Dermatologic Manifestations of Stevens-Johnson Syndrome and Toxic Epidermal Necrolysis
B. Fixed Drug Eruption
C. Discoid Lupus Erythematosus
D. Erythema Annulare Centrifugum
E. Drug-Induced Bullous Disorders

Question: An 18-year-old male presents to the clinic with complaints of muscle aches and stiffness after engaging in an intense workout session. He reports no history of trauma or injury during the exercise but mentions that the pain developed gradually a few hours after completing his workout. Additionally, he noticed dark-colored urine and mild swelling in his muscles. Blood tests reveal elevated levels of creatine kinase and myoglobin. Based on the symptoms and findings, what is the most likely diagnosis?
Options: A. Phosphofructokinase deficiency
B. Rhabdomyolysis
C. Guillain-Barré syndrome
D. Carnitine palmitoyl transferase deficiency

Question: A 48-year-old man recently returned from a two-week vacation in the Caribbean during the rainy season. He reported being frequently bitten by mosquitoes while there. A few days after returning, he began experiencing intermittent episodes of high fever, severe pain in his lower back, wrists, and other joints, along with the development of a diffuse, red rash. The pain is debilitating, and he mentions it worsens with movement. He also describes feeling fatigued and experiencing muscle aches. No significant medical history or chronic illnesses are noted.
Given his travel history, symptoms, and exposure to mosquitoes, what is the most likely diagnosis?
A. Dengue fever
B. O'nyong-nyong fever
C. West Nile fever
D. Chikungunya

Question:
A 50-year-old woman visits the clinic with complaints of an intensely itchy rash 🩹 on her skin. She mentions that two days ago, she spent several hours relaxing in a hot tub 🛁 that was also used by multiple family members on the same day. Upon examination, you notice pruritic (itchy) papules and pustules on her chest, back, and buttocks 🫣.
What is the most likely diagnosis?
A. Irritant Contact Dermatitis (caused by contact with irritating substances)
B. Pseudomonas Folliculitis (infection from bacteria commonly found in hot tubs)
C. Miliaria Rubra (heat rash caused by blocked sweat glands)
D. Seabather's Eruption (rash caused by exposure to larvae in the sea)
